3.6 Analysis mode
Manual mode
In manual mode, the cap of the sample tube is manually removed and each sample is
aspirated individually via the whole blood aspiration pipette.
Capillary mode
In capillary mode, the sample diluted to 1:5 is aspirated manually via the whole blood
aspiration pipette, analyzed, displayed and reported.
Sampler mode
The sampler automatically mixes, aspirates and analyzes samples without removing their
caps. Up to 100 samples can be loaded at a time and analyzed automatically.
Manual closed mode
In manual closed mode, the sampler is used to aspirate the sample, without opening the cap
of the sample tube. This mode is basically the same as manual mode; mixing and
continuous analysis can not be performed automatically.
Note:
HPC analysis and body fluid analysis can only be performed in manual mode.
